About Dan K. Marker

Dan K. Marker is a scholar working on Biomedical Engineering, Electrical and Electronic Engineering, Civil and Structural Engineering, Atomic and Molecular Physics, and Optics and Aerospace Engineering, having authored 34 papers that have together received 307 indexed citations. Recurring topics across this work include Advanced Surface Polishing Techniques (16 papers), Structural Analysis and Optimization (10 papers), Adaptive optics and wavefront sensing (10 papers), Semiconductor Lasers and Optical Devices (7 papers), Advanced Materials and Mechanics (5 papers), Optical Wireless Communication Technologies (5 papers), Optical Coatings and Gratings (5 papers) and Silicone and Siloxane Chemistry (4 papers). The work is most often cited by research in Civil and Structural Engineering (113 citations), Atomic and Molecular Physics, and Optics (128 citations), Aerospace Engineering (72 citations), Surfaces, Coatings and Films (15 citations) and Biomedical Engineering (91 citations). Dan K. Marker has collaborated with scholars based in United States. Frequent co-authors include Christopher H. Jenkins, Mark F. Spencer, Chris Jenkins, James D. Moore, Christopher Jenkins, R. J. Wilkes, Arup Maji and Ethan Holt. Their work appears in journals such as Optics Express, Journal of Solar Energy Engineering, IEEE Transactions on Microwave Theory and Techniques, Journal of Spacecraft and Rockets and Optical Engineering.
